A few weeks ago, I came across a media release in the Business and Financial Times by the National Communication Authority (NCA) on a new numbering plan for fixed line telephony operators in Ghana. According to the release which was also posted on the NCA’s website:
** The current 53 area codes (021, 022, 051, 061, 0742 etc) will be reduced to 10 regional codes
REGIONS (CURRENT AREA CODES) ➲ NEW CODES
GREATER-ACCRA (021, 022, 0968) ➲ 030
WESTERN (0342, 0345, 0362, 0392, 0394, 0394) ➲ 031
ASHANTI (051, 0531, 0561, 0565, 0572, 0582) ➲ 032
CENTRAL (041, 042, 0372, 0432) ➲ 033
EASTERN (081, 0832, 0842, 0846, 0848, 0858, 0863, 0872, 0876, 0882, 0251) ➲ 034
BRONG-AHAFO (061, 0632, 0648, 0652, 0653, 0567, 0568) ➲ 035
VOLTA (091, 0931, 0935, 0936, 0953, 0962, 0966) ➲ 036
NORTHERN (071, 0715, 0716, 0717, 0744, 0746, 0752) ➲ 037
UPPER-EAST (072, 0742, 0743) ➲ 038
UPPER-WEST (0756) ➲ 039
** The length of all regional codes will be the same as shown above.
** All user numbers will have the same digit length by the addition of a digit prefixed to user numbers in Accra and Tema and two digits prefixed to all other users in the country i.e Accra and Tema will now have an 8-digit phone numbers (However, Zain fixed lines will maintain 7-digit user numbers) & the other towns in Ghana will move from 5-digit numbers to 7 digits
Area Old Assignment New Assignment
Accra & Tema (021) 1234567 (031) X1234567
All Other Towns (061) 12345 (035) XX12345
Accra & Tema (Zain) (021) 70XXXXX (030) 70XXXXX
Zain Ghana has already implemented the new numbering plan.
